Hi community, we'd like to share an update as we've released new size options for a few more widgets. In addition to the Chart of accounts watchlist and Cash in and out you now have the option to Resize the following widgets;
- Tasks
- Net profit or loss
- Bills to pay
- Invoices owed to you
Along with this release, once the Homepage is saved and when the Small option is selected for either Bills to pay, or Invoices owed to you widgets, there'll be the option to toggle the chart on or off from the Homepage.
We'll be extending Resize out to more widgets soon, so I'll continue to keep you updated here.

The only option for re-sizing the accounts watchlist is to double the size. At double the size, there is so much white space it is unreadable; at the base size it's so spread out it's unusable (see screenshot comparing new to old - you can see that in the old version, because it's a LITTLE wider, the account names mostly fit on one line, and all the accounts I want to see are visible. In the new, the padding around each line takes up almost as much space as the line itself, so because the account names all take two lines, you can fit ONE account in the space the old uses for nearly THREE.)
Because the listed accounts are all in account number order, the ones I want to keep an eye on on a daily basis - wages payable, super payable, PAYG payable, suspense - are all hidden because they're at the bottom and I can't increase the length of the widget to accommodate the excess of white space and the text wrapping.
Even with an unwrapped text line, in the old view, it's about 10mm between the information on the line above and the information on the line below the line I'm actually looking at. In the new view, it's 18mm. There is Too Much White Space for the usability of the information presented - you don't put oodles of Pretty White Space in between lines of information in a table, because it becomes unreadable and unusable!
